Member research in the Dornely and Whitmarsh regions shows strong preference for immediate value over deferred points. Migration would run over two quarters, with legacy balances honoured in full to limit attrition risk. Finance and legal have reviewed the liability treatment and raised no objections. The commercial rationale driving the timing is stated confidentially below.

management briefing: Jorixax Holdings is in early talks to buy Casixax Holdings for about $420.3 million. The Fenmir launch date is October 27, and nothing goes to the press before then. Legal wants the Keloxek Foods term sheet redrafted before April 16.

## Deployment: Profile Store Sharding

The Tarnwick profile store is sharded by account hash across eight partitions. Resharding runs as a dual-write migration: new writes land on both rings until the backfill completes. If you are paged mid-migration, check the backfill lag gauge first; lag above five minutes means you should pause the cutover, not roll back. Verify each shard's replica count before resuming. The migration coordinator expects the values listed below.

service settings:
[casax]
port = 6379
team = rusir
host = casax.zemvarhq.corp
region = outer-4
access_code = ac_9808ce
timeout_ms = 1500

# Proselint-D Environments

Proselint-D, our documentation linter, runs as a service in three environments: sandbox, review, and mainline. Sandbox rebuilds on every push and applies the loosest rule set; review mirrors mainline rules but posts advisory comments only; mainline blocks merges on rule violations. New team members should test custom rules in sandbox first, then promote via the review pipeline. Each environment reads its own settings; mainline currently runs with the values below.

deployment values, bahop-yadug:
[caswyn]
port = 8443
region = east-4
host = caswyn.lumicworks.internal
timeout_ms = 5000
retries = 8

☐ Off-site run — Valmere Archive film reels

Confirm all six reels from the Corlan Collection are sealed in their climate cases, desiccant packs refreshed, and each case strapped upright in the transit crate. Verify the crate stays below 18°C during loading and is never stacked. The archive's intake clerk must sign the manifest on arrival. Before the courier departs our dock, the dispatch desk must relay the confidential hand-over instruction that follows:

handover note for yagef-bagep: the drudor pelius courier leaves the kasdor zorvan norir ledger at gate 8016 under passcode 755406